Blonde Hair with Brown Highlights
As a rule of thumb, always remember that blonde hair with brown highlights doesn't suit everyone. So however attractive it may sound, you shouldn't get it done for yourself until you are sure about it. Blond hair with brown highlights is a disaster for blonds with pale complexion and cool skin tone. The cool skin tone is the one that don't easily get tanned. This kind of skin tone has gray or blue undertones. Adding brown highlights in blonde hair with such cool skin tone is an absolute nightmare. Such people should go for other subtle highlights, which can soothe the eyes, like the beige, ash, taupe and wheat. On the other hand, people having warm as well as ruddy skin tones can definitely try blonde hair with brown highlights.
Warm skin tone has hues of gold, peach and pink as undertones and it gets easily and evenly tanned. This kind of skin tone is ideal for brown and other rich hair highlights like straw, bronze, caramel and subtle shades of brown and red. If you bear warm skin tones you can even try short blonde hair with brown highlights, which is the splash of the season. If you bear ruddy skin tone with strong red undertones that get flushed really easily, then blonde hair with brown highlights is the best choice that you have. Try honey brown, beige and golden brown highlights in blonde hair and see the difference. More on hair colors for your skin tone.
Brown highlights can really accentuate your skin and make your original blonde hair look all the more ravishing. Lastly, it is important to consider your eye color. Select the highlight colors
according to your particular skin tone and once you do that, I think the eye color will surely match with it. Blonde hair with brown highlights can suit any eye color, apart from light blue and light green eyes.
